Transaction 9938fb950ce74588147c1332d740e5d14155342c9ae2051e866ef6bb929625a8
1 Input
1 Output
-
9938fb950ce74588147c1332d740e5d14155342c9ae2051e866ef6bb929625a8:0
- value
- 60958
- script pubkey
- OP_0 OP_PUSHBYTES_20 c624628a5cbbb2980be00c493356807924af6fe1
- address
- bc1qccjx9zjuhwefszlqp3ynx45q0yj27mlp4p6xv5